I purchased a 2000 off of eBay and the listing stated that the unit was virgin except for a 40+ and 40- mod.
I received the unit and it looked great. Kicked ass on AM but had total modulation distortion on SSB. And also a pretty loud buzzing or hum when the mic was keyed on SSB with no audio into the mic. (this noise was heard on receiving end of another radio, not the 2000)
Reports said that the signal was very strong on SSB but the voice was worbley (that was the word used) or distorted to the point of not being able to understand it.
After doing some research and learning just a bit I opened her up for a peak.
First thing that I found was that R131 had been cut. R126 was removed and replaced with a jumper. R124 has also been removed. There are also some other areas on the board where I feel parts have been removed or otherwise messed with. These areas can be seen in the pics.
I took it to someone I know pretty well that works on radios and without the exact parts, he played with it and ended up placing a 300 ohm resistor at one end of where R124 goes and at one end of where R126 goes. This solved the humming/buzzing and over modulation problem. (also removed jumper wire)
Now... however... while the transmit audio on SSB is loud and clear, it still has a ton of outrageous modulation. (at about 20% Dynamic Mic volume)
You can hold a stock mic even a foot or so away from you while speaking in a normal tone of voice and it sounds like a bodacious D-104 with a KW behind it.
I would like to figure out what all has been done to this radio (besides the 80 channel mod and the unlocked clarifier mod) so that I can restore it back to original. I will leave the unlocked clarifier and the 80 channel mod, but I wish all power and modulation circuits to be original.
